Passmark

This is the most ubiquitous GPU benchmark. It gives the graphics card a thorough evaluation under various types of load, providing four separate benchmarks for Direct3D versions 9, 10, 11 and 12 (the last being done in 4K resolution if possible), and few more tests engaging DirectCompute capabilities.

Pros & cons summary


Performance score 1.59 66.88
Recency 1 February 2010 28 October 2020
Maximum RAM amount 1 GB 16 GB
Chip lithography 65 nm 7 nm
Power consumption (TDP) 75 Watt 300 Watt

GTX 285M has 300% lower power consumption.

RX 6900 XT, on the other hand, has a 4106.3% higher aggregate performance score, an age advantage of 10 years, a 1500% higher maximum VRAM amount, and a 828.6% more advanced lithography process.

The Radeon RX 6900 XT is our recommended choice as it beats the GeForce GTX 285M in performance tests.

Be aware that GeForce GTX 285M is a notebook card while Radeon RX 6900 XT is a desktop one.
